Short lecture on the use of even and odd functions with the harmonic oscillator. Harmonic oscillator wavefunctions are composed of normalization constants, Hermite polynomials, and Gaussian functions. The normalization constants and Gaussian functions are always even functions. The Hermite polynomials are always either fully even or fully odd functions. Thus any harmonic oscillator wavefunction is always either completely even or completely odd. The position and momentum operators are both odd operators. The expectation value integral contains two wavefunctions and an operator. The product of two wavefunctions is always a product of even and even or odd and odd, and thus is always even. This gives an expectation value for position and momentum which is always odd, and thus are both zero for all harmonic oscillator wavefunctions.
